Próbuje zrobić program zmieniający system binarny na dziesiętny w pythonie. Wie ktoś co jest tu źle i jak to naprawić?
i = 0
suma = 0
dlugosc = int(input("Podaj bin: "))
if i < dlugosc(bin):
c = (bin[dlugosc(bin) - 1])
suma = suma + c * 2 ^ i
i = i +1
suma = int(dlugosc,2)
else:
print(suma)


Próbuje Zrobić Program Zmieniający System Binarny Na Dziesiętny W Pythonie Wie Ktoś Co Jest Tu Źle I Jak To Naprawić I 0 Suma 0 Dlugosc IntinputPodaj Bin If I L class=